How Will the Linear Particle Accelerators Market Grow, and What Is the Projected Market Size?
The market for linear particle accelerators has seen significant growth in the past few years. The market, which was worth $2.59 billion in 2024, is projected to increase to $2.75 billion in 2025, marking a compound annual growth rate (CAGR) of 6.4%. The expansion during the historical period can be linked to rising needs for cancer therapy, government support and financing, superior treatment results, healthcare facilities development, as well as cooperation and alliances.

The market for linear particle accelerators is projected to witness robust expansion in the coming years, escalating to a worth of $3.48 billion in 2029 with a cumulative yearly growth rate (CAGR) of 6.0%. Factors contributing to this upward trend during the predicted period include the escalating need for precision medicine, the rising uptake of proton therapy, the aging demographic, evolving markets, and investments into research and development. Significant movements in the forecast range encompass the incorporation of artificial intelligence, the broadening of proton therapy, personalized medical practices, less invasive treatment options, and the worldwide market expansion.

What Are the Key Drivers Behind the Growth of the Linear Particle Accelerators Market?
The burgeoning emphasis on precision medicine is anticipated to spur the expansion of the linear particle accelerators market. Precision medicine is a revolutionary strategy in healthcare that customizes medical therapies and interventions based on individual patient's unique attributes. This intensified focus on precision medicine is being motivated by advancements in genomic technology and research, recognizing the constraints of conventional healthcare strategies and the potential of customized treatments for improved results. Linear particle accelerators are used in precision medicine to provide targeted radiation treatment, ensuring precise tumor targeting while minimizing harm to surrounding healthy tissues. For example, in 2022, the US-based professional membership entity, the Personalized Medicine Coalition, reported that the Food and Drug Administration's Center for Drug Evaluation and Research (CDER) approved 37 new molecular entities (NMEs). Of the 35 therapeutic NMEs, approximately 34% or 12 of them, have been categorized as personalized medicines by the Personalized Medicine Coalition (PMC). Consequently, the increasing focus on precision medicine is propelling the linear particle accelerators market's growth.

Which Key Developments Are Influencing the Linear Particle Accelerators Market?
Leading entities within the linear particle accelerators industry are pushing the boundary by producing cutting-edge solutions, such as the AI-infused adaptive computed tomography linear particle accelerators (CT-Linac). These medical devices are designed to improve cancer treatments by providing increased accuracy, tailored therapy, and up-to-the-minute imaging capabilities, thus enhancing patient results. These AI-enhanced adaptive computed tomography linear particle accelerators marry artificial intelligence algorithms with computed tomography techniques and particle acceleration functions to deliver precise, customised radiation therapy treatments, accompanied by real-time imaging and adaptive treatment planning. For example, Elekta, a human care company based in Sweden, introduced Elekta Evo, an AI-enabled, adaptive CT-Linac in May 2024. Specially crafted for radiation therapy, this linear particle accelerator gives medical professionals an unmatched level of precision and adaptability in cancer treatments. Elekta Evo leverages advanced imaging technologies, anatomy-specific algorithms and powerful AI to fine-tune treatment planning, minimalize potential harm to at-risk organs and diminish uncertainty, thereby setting new standards for image quality and online adaptability.
